Job description
As a CPU Design Timing Engineer at Apple, you will be responsible for ensuring timing closure for CPU projects. You will collaborate with various teams, including CAD, micro-architects, and implementation engineers, to develop and refine timing flows. Your role will involve conducting timing analysis and addressing any timing-related challenges. This position requires a strong background in digital design and a passion for innovation in technology.
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in a relevant field and 3+ years of experience in timing analysis.
- Experience with static timing analysis and noise analysis.
- Proficiency in TCL and either Perl or Python.
- Familiarity with static timing analysis tools such as PrimeTime® or Tempus®.
- Knowledge of physical design tools and methodologies.
Responsibilities
- Develop the timing flow for the project in collaboration with the CAD team.
- Script to improve analysis flows and engineer efficiency.
- Work extensively with CPU micro-architects and implementation engineers to drive timing closure.
- Perform timing analysis in high-speed digital designs.
- Address noise issues in designs and conduct variation modeling.
